About Liang Wang
Liang Wang is a scholar working on Fuel Technology, Biomaterials and Biomedical Engineering, having authored 140 papers that have together received 4.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Thermochemical Biomass Conversion Processes (23 papers), Graphene and Nanomaterials Applications (16 papers),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(13 papers), Iron and Steelmaking Processes (8 papers), Lignin and Wood Chemistry (7 papers), Nanoparticles: synthesis and applications (7 papers), Graphene research and applications (7 papers) and Supramolecular Self-Assembly in Materials (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omaterials (704 citations), Biomedical Engineering (2.2k citations) and Materials Chemistry (1.9k citations). Liang Wang has collaborated with scholars based in China, Australia and Singapore. Frequent co-authors include Yuan Chen, E. T. Kang, K. G. Neoh, Rongrong Jiang, Jun Wei, Jianliang Zhang, Borys Shuter, Yingbo Dong, Hai Lin and Yinhai He. Their work appears in journ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, Nano Letters and Biomaterials.
